Sarah R. Catford is affiliated with the Hudson Institute of Medical Research in Clayton, Melbourne, Australia, and holds a position in the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ology at Monash University, also located in Clayton, Melbourne, Australia. Her research primarily focuses on gynecological and reproductive health.

Research Contributions

Sarah R. Catford has made significant contributions to the field of gynecology, with a notable publication in 2019 titled "Germ cell arrest associated with aSETX mutation in ataxia oculomotor apraxia type 2." This paper, published in Reproductive BioMedicine Online, explores the genetic factors associated with germ cell arrest, particularly focusing on the aSETX mutation in the context of ataxia oculomotor apraxia type 2.
